Marketing Operations Manager jobs in Sydney NSW

• The average pay for Marketing Operations Manager jobs in Sydney NSW is $110K per year.
• Entry-level positions start at $90K per year, while the most experienced workers can earn up to $130K per year.
• Top skills include MARKET RESEARCH, HTML, CSS, PROJECT MANAGEMENT and JAVASCRIPT.
